What reviewers typically evaluate

  • Lace type: HD lace, Swiss lace or transparent lace—each affects translucency, durability, and how invisible the hairline looks under different lighting.
  • Cap design: Full lace, lace front, 360 lace, and hand-tied versus machine-sewn areas. Cap size and inner elastic bands influence fit.
  • Hair origin and processing: Virgin vs. remy vs. synthetic fibers; chemical processing alters longevity and styling versatility.
  • Density and weight: From light-density (120%) to heavy-density (200%), affecting volume and realism.
  • Knots and bleaching: Pre-bleached knots reduce the need for heavy customization; unbleached knots often require skill to camouflage.
  • Color match and blendability: Does the wig shade blend with your natural hair or skin tone? Are tonal options available for balayage or highlights?
  • Comfort and ventilation: How breathable is the base? Are there adjustable straps, combs, or silicone grips?
  • Longevity and care: How the wig responds to regular washing, heat styling, and adhesive removal.

In-Depth Comparisons: How the Picks Differ

Comparative reviews often focus on subtle tradeoffs. For instance, the highest realism (HD lace) may compromise on extreme durability because HD lace is thinner and more delicate. Conversely, thicker Swiss lace might withstand more handling but require more blending work to perfect the hairline. Price often correlates with hair quality and handwork—expect to pay more for individually hand-tied units and virgin hair that can be restyled repeatedly.

Customization and DIY tips from reviewers

Most detailed a list lace wigs reviews include a customization section. Common recommendations:

  • Pre-pluck sparingly: removing too much hairline density can create gaps; follow video tutorials that show gradual thinning.
  • Bleach knots smartly: use a gentle developer and check progress frequently to avoid damaging lace or hair shafts.
  • Tint lace when the lace tone slightly mismatches your skin by using lace tint sprays or a thin layer of foundation designed for lace.
  • Secure adhesives: use medical-grade adhesive or mesh tape for extended wear; always patch-test and follow removal protocols to protect skin and natural hair.
  • Seal the hairline with a light foundation or concealer for a flawless scalp illusion under bright lights.

Care and Maintenance: What the Reviews Reveal

Consistent patterns in a list lace wigs reviews emphasize prevention: proper washing technique, minimal mechanical stress, and targeted product use extend a wig's lifespan. Here are practical steps many reviewers swear by:

Daily and weekly routine

  • Use sulfate-free, moisturizing shampoos and conditioners; avoid heavy silicones that can weigh down the hair and build up on lace.
  • Apply a lightweight leave-in conditioner and detangle with a wide-tooth comb from ends to roots.
  • Air-dry on a wig stand when possible to preserve cap shape and minimize heat damage.
  • When heat styling, use a high-quality thermal protectant and keep tools under 350°F (about 175°C) for human hair wigs.

Long-term care and storage

  1. Rotate between multiple wigs to reduce daily wear stress on any single piece.
  2. Store on a mannequin head or padded hanger in breathable bags to maintain shape and protect lace.
  3. Schedule professional deep conditioning for virgin hair wigs every few months if worn frequently.

Common problems found in reviews and how to fix them

Scanning cross-cutting a list lace wigs reviews surfaces some common complaints and proven fixes:

  • Visible knots — solution: bleach or carefully tint knots and use a thin layer of concealer at the part.
  • Unnatural shine — solution: apply a matte-finish dry shampoo or professional hair powder to reduce synthetic-looking gloss.
  • Fraying lace edges — solution: trim minimally and seal edges with a fabric-specific glue or sew-on edge for added strength.
  • Heavy shedding — solution: reduce aggressive brushing, use silk/satin inside caps, and inspect ventilations; severe shedding may indicate lower-quality hair bundles.

Q: How often should I wash a human hair lace wig?
A: Most reviewers recommend washing every 7–14 wears depending on product buildup and activity level; use gentle, sulfate-free products.

Q: Can I sleep in a lace wig?
A: It's not recommended to sleep in lace wigs regularly because friction can tangle fibers and stress the lace; use a satin bonnet or sleep on a satin pillow if you must.

Q: How can I make my lace wig look more like my scalp?
A: Use a lace tint spray or carefully applied foundation along the part and hairline; bleaching knots (if comfortable) and pre-plucking lightly also help.

Q: Are synthetic lace wigs a good alternative?
A: Modern high-heat synthetic hair can give excellent realism at lower prices but has limited styling heat tolerance and shorter lifespan compared to remy human hair.
